**Alert: SeatScape render latency > 4s (Orpheum Hall)** — So the seat-map renderer for the Gilderoy Theatre is taking forever to paint the mezzanine tiles again. Usually this means the venue-geometry cache expired mid-sale and every request is rebuilding the SVG from scratch. Check the cache-hit graph first; if it's cratered, warm the cache manually before the evening rush. Don't restart the renderer during an active on-sale. The warm-up procedure is documented on the internal runbook page.

runbook for kageg-yafof: https://jira.norvalabs.test/board/view/secrets/job/ticket/board/board/2bc6c981aafb1e8fe00a8459

The Larkspur reminder job runs nightly at 02:00, querying the Bellwether clinic scheduler for appointments within the next 72 hours and dispatching SMS reminders via the Chimeline gateway. Maintainers should note the job retries failed dispatches twice with exponential backoff before logging to the dead-letter table. Every call to the Chimeline gateway must authenticate with the bearer token listed below.

session JWT of yawep-yawep = eyJhbGciOiJIUzI1NiIsInR5cCI6IkpXVCJ9.eyJzdWIiOiI3pWF3_In0.aXYsHiog

## Changelog — ThumbForge v2.4

Heads up for review: we changed the default behavior of the thumbnail generation queue. Previously, failed render jobs were retried indefinitely, which let a single corrupt upload hog workers for hours. Now retries cap at three, then the job lands in a quarantine queue for manual triage. Max concurrent renders also dropped from 32 to 12 per node. Nothing else touched. The defaults now shipped with the service are as follows.

settings of tagef-bawif:
DRUIX_HOST=druix.zemvarlabs.internal
DRUIX_PORT=8000

Ticket: Staging env misconfigured for Siftgate bloom filter

The bloom layer in front of the Pellet KV store is rejecting all lookups in staging because the env file was copied from the dev template without credentials. False-positive tuning values are fine; only the auth line is missing. To unblock the weekly demo, the Pellet admission secret must be set on the following line.

env line for yaguf-fajop: LEDGER_TOKEN13=fb08984397349